Lady Tiger volleyball defeats Seneca

Wednesday, October 8, 2008

The Nevada Lady Tigers volleyball team tacked on another win as they defeated Seneca Monday night.

In the first set, Nevada had to mount a comeback win as they found themselves down 8-11 until Taylor Means went back to serve and sent Nevada on an 8-0 run to take a 17-11 lead on their way to a 25-18 win. The Lady Tigers were able to stay in control in the second set to take the win by the same score, 25-18.

Mariah Mock and Jessica Harper led the team with eight kills each while Means tacked on 12 points with five kills. Kori Lowery had a team-high 10 assists with four kills and Brooke Silvola added another seven assists.

The JV team had similar success as they defeated Seneca in convincing fashion 25-11, 25-7. Both teams were scheduled to be in action again on Tuesday as they were set to travel to Ash Grove High School with their next home match coming on Thursday against McDonald County High School.
